What if an Aadhaar Number holder misplaces or forgets their Aadhaar number? Check all the possible methods here.
Misplacing or forgetting your Aadhaar number can be a stressful situation, given its importance in various transactions and services in India.
However, the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) has anticipated this problem and provided several solutions to help Aadhaar holders retrieve their numbers easily and securely.
If you find yourself in this situation, here are the steps you can take:
- Use the Online Retrieval Service:
- Visit https://myaadhaar.uidai.gov.in/
- Use the “Retrieve Lost UID/EID” service
- This is a quick and convenient way to recover your Aadhaar number
- Contact the UIDAI Helpline:
- Call the toll-free number 1947
- A Contact Centre Agent will assist you in getting your Enrollment ID (EID)
- With the EID, you can then download your eAadhaar from the MyAadhaar Portal
- Utilize the IVRS System:
- Call 1947 to access the Interactive Voice Response System
- You can retrieve your Aadhaar number using your Enrollment ID (EID) through this automated system
These methods ensure that even if you misplace your Aadhaar number, you’re not left without options. The UIDAI has designed these retrieval processes to be user-friendly and accessible, minimizing the inconvenience caused by a lost or forgotten Aadhaar number.
Remember, when using any of these methods, you may need to provide additional information to verify your identity, such as your name, date of birth, or registered mobile number. This is a security measure to protect your Aadhaar information from unauthorized access.
